the solis project

Who : People experiencing a social emergency or in a condition of severe social vulnerability.

How : The Solis Project was initiated as part of a national program dedicated to confronting social exclusion and poverty through the development of integrated initiatives which would encourage local, dynamic partnerships between non profit organizations, companies and social agencies.

Program offered in Portugal

In addition to Casa Azul, a Dianova center dedicated to temporary lodging, the Solis Project brings together several types of participating social service agencies, some of which are as follows:

Dianova’s Casa Azul temporary housing center has 12 places for temporary housing (6 months maximum), 3 places for emergency housing (1 month maximum) and an apartment for families. Those entering Casa Azul are supervised by experienced professionals from many fields, dedicated to providing them with social and psychological counseling, as well as supporting their health and judicial needs and offering them occupational counseling and job-training.

Why : To fulfill the need for emergency lodging for people in social distress, to provide them with appropriate counseling and support, to assist them in dealing with government agencies and to help them develop skills and competency levels that will optimize a successful reintegration into normal society.

 

The Dianova Network

The Network
Situated in 12 countries of Europe and the Americas, the Dianova network is composed of non-profit member organizations that are dedicated to providing social programs and developing innovative initiatives in the fields of addiction prevention and treatment, education and youth development.
